/* listes */ .listagebloc { margin-bottom: 2em; } #contextes .listagebloc { font-size: 10px; } h2 { letter-spacing: 0.05em; } #corps h2 { padding: 0.2em 0.4em; display: inline; background-color: #999; color: #fff; font-size: 12px; font-weight: normal; } #edito h2 { display:none; } #contextes h2 { font-size: 12px; color: #f00; margin-bottom: 0.5em; } h4 { line-height: 130%; margin-bottom: 0.2em; } #corps h4 { font-size: 16px; } #contextes h4 { font-size: 12px; } .listageconteneur { padding-top: 0.5em; } .listageconteneur li { margin: 0; clear: left; padding: 0 0 0.6em 0; } #contextes .listageconteneur li { padding: 0 0 0.4em 0; } .listagelogo { float: left; margin: 0 0.5em 0.5em 0; } .listagelogo img { border: 1px solid #333; } .listagetexte { font-size: 11px; line-height: 130%; margin-bottom: 0.5em; } #contextes .listagetexte { font-size: 9px; } .listageinfo { margin: 0 0 0.5em 0; color: #666; } .listageinfo a { color: #7E0101; } .listageinfo a:hover { color: #CC0000; } #corps .listageinfo { font-size: 10px; } #contextes .listageinfo { font-size: 9px; } .listagesite { margin: 1em 0 0.5em 0 } .listagesite strong { color: #c00; } #contextes .listagesite { font-size: 10px; } #corps .listagesite { font-size: 10px; } .listageinfo strong { font-weight: normal; } .listagesuite { font-size: 10px; margin:1em 0; } .listagerepondre { text-align: right; padding-right: 20px; margin: 0 2em 1em 0; } #corps .listagerepondre { margin:1em 0; font-size: 10px; } #contextes .listagerepondre { margin:0.6em 0; font-size: 9px; } .listagerepondre a { color: #7e0101; } .listagerepondre a:hover { color: #c00; } /* liste des rubriques */ #rubinrub h2 { background-color: #f00; } /* forum */ #corps #forum ul ul { margin-left: 2em; margin-bottom: 0.2em; } #corps #forum .listageconteneur li { margin-bottom: 0.5em; padding-bottom: 0.2em; border-bottom: 1px solid #ccc; } #corps #forum .listageconteneur li li { border-bottom: 0; }